Text copied to clipboard!
Название
Text copied to clipboard!Ведущий разработчик React
Описание
Text copied to clipboard!
Мы ищем Ведущего разработчика React, который присоединится к нашей команде и возглавит разработку современных веб-приложений. В этой роли вы будете отвечать за архитектуру, реализацию и поддержку интерфейсных решений, а также за руководство командой разработчиков. Вы будете тесно сотрудничать с дизайнерами, бэкенд-разработчиками и менеджерами проектов для создания высококачественных продуктов, соответствующих требованиям бизнеса и пользователей.
Кандидат должен обладать глубокими знаниями JavaScript, React, TypeScript и современных инструментов фронтенд-разработки. Опыт в построении масштабируемых приложений, внедрении лучших практик и наставничестве менее опытных разработчиков является обязательным. Мы ценим инициативность, ответственность и стремление к постоянному профессиональному росту.
Ведущий разработчик React будет играть ключевую роль в принятии технических решений, выборе технологий и обеспечении высокого качества кода. Вы будете участвовать в планировании спринтов, код-ревью, оптимизации производительности и обеспечении безопасности приложений. Также важно умение эффективно коммуницировать и работать в команде, а также способность адаптироваться к быстро меняющимся требованиям проекта.
Если вы стремитесь к лидерству, хотите влиять на архитектуру продуктов и развиваться в профессиональной среде, мы будем рады видеть вас в нашей команде.
Обязанности
Text copied to clipboard!- Руководство командой фронтенд-разработчиков
- Разработка и поддержка веб-приложений на React
- Проектирование архитектуры клиентской части
- Проведение код-ревью и наставничество
- Оптимизация производительности интерфейса
- Интеграция с REST и GraphQL API
- Обеспечение соответствия стандартам безопасности
- Участие в планировании и оценке задач
- Внедрение лучших практик разработки
- Сотрудничество с дизайнерами и бэкенд-командой
Требования
Text copied to clipboard!- Опыт работы с React от 4 лет
- Глубокие знания JavaScript и TypeScript
- Опыт работы с Redux, React Router, Webpack
- Понимание принципов REST и GraphQL
- Опыт в построении архитектуры SPA
- Навыки руководства командой и проведения код-ревью
- Знание современных инструментов CI/CD
- Опыт написания тестов (Jest, React Testing Library)
- Умение работать в Agile/Scrum среде
- Хорошие коммуникативные навыки
Возможные вопросы на интервью
Text copied to clipboard!- Какой у вас опыт работы с React и TypeScript?
- Расскажите о проекте, где вы выступали в роли тимлида.
- Какие архитектурные решения вы принимали в последних проектах?
- Как вы обеспечиваете качество и читаемость кода в команде?
- Как вы подходите к оптимизации производительности React-приложений?
- Какой опыт у вас есть с тестированием фронтенда?
- Какие инструменты CI/CD вы использовали?
- Как вы решаете конфликты в команде?
- Как вы обучаете и поддерживаете менее опытных разработчиков?
- Какие библиотеки и фреймворки вы предпочитаете использовать с React?